Understanding what sets a credit union apart is the first step. Unlike traditional banks, credit unions are not-for-profit cooperatives owned by their members. This structure often translates into lower fees, more competitive loan rates, and higher savings yields. For families and individuals in Newborn, this can mean real savings on auto loans, mortgages, and everyday banking. The decision often comes down to a focus on people versus profits. When you bank at a credit union, you're a member with a vote, not just a customer with an account number.
